The theme of our stall at the Huntingdon Carnival next Saturday 10th August is GUESS! After much debate at our monthly meetings we came upon the idea because despite members regularly attending meetings of the Clinical Commissioning Group (the purse-string holders), the Sustainability & Transformation Partnership Board (the talkers) and the county Health Scrutiny Committee – the evershifting pieces of the local NHS Jigsaw make it almost impossible to get a firm grasp on the picture.

Huge changes are taking place but are being made largely unnoticed by the general public due to the secretive and oblique nature of the workings of the various committees and organisations involved – not to mention the big daddy Quango NHS England and NHS Improvement pulling lots of strings too…

So that is why at the Carnival we are asking people to GUESS what is going on with the local NHS? For example… Guess where this is?

Did you know that this existed here in Huntingdon?

We’ll also be asking people to guess the cost of SELF-PAY treatments and explaining why it is not a stupid question – self-pay/self-funding is becoming a common sight at NHS Foundation Trusts it seems. Guess how much the Clinical Commissioning Group are planning to CUT this year? Guess what hospitals are now merged into NWAFT?
